C#使用Ado.net讀取Excel表的方法
本文實(shí)例講述了C#使用Ado.net讀取Excel表的方法。分享給大家供大家參考。具體分析如下:
微軟NET提供了一個(gè)交互的方法,通過使用ADO.NET與Microsoft Office程序??梢允褂脙?nèi)置的OLEDB來訪問Excel的XLS表格。下面的例子演示了如何在C#編程讀取Excel工作表。需要引用System.Data.OleDb庫
using System;
using System.Data.OleDb;
namespace ConsoleApplication1
{
class Program
{
static void Main()
{
string connString = "Provider=Microsoft.Jet.OleDb.4.0; data source=c:\\sample.xls; Extended Properties=Excel 8.0;";
// Select using a Worksheet name
string selectqry = "SELECT * FROM [Sheet1$]";
OleDbConnection conn = new OleDbConnection(connString);
OleDbCommand cmd = new OleDbCommand(selectqry,con);
try
{
con.Open();
OleDbDataReader theDatardr = cmd.ExecuteReader();
while (theDatardr.Read())
{
Console.WriteLine("{0}:{1}({2})–{3}({4})",theDatardr.GetString(0),theDatardr.GetString(1),theDatardr.GetString(2),theDatardr.GetString(3),theDatardr.GetString(4));
}
}
catch (Exception ex)
{
Console.WriteLine(ex.Message);
}
finally
{
con.Dispose();
}
}
}
}
希望本文所述對(duì)大家的C#程序設(shè)計(jì)有所幫助。
- C#使用ADO.Net部件來訪問Access數(shù)據(jù)庫的方法
- asp.net(C#) Access 數(shù)據(jù)操作類
- ACCESS的參數(shù)化查詢,附VBSCRIPT(ASP)和C#(ASP.NET)函數(shù)
- ASP.net(c#)用類的思想實(shí)現(xiàn)插入數(shù)據(jù)到ACCESS例子
- C#使用Ado.Net更新和添加數(shù)據(jù)到Excel表格的方法
- ASP.NET(C#) 讀取EXCEL另加解決日期問題的方法分享
- ASP.NET(C#)讀取Excel的文件內(nèi)容
- ADO.NET 讀取EXCEL的實(shí)現(xiàn)代碼((c#))
- asp.net(C#)操作excel(上路篇)
- 在Asp.net用C#建立動(dòng)態(tài)Excel
- C#.net編程創(chuàng)建Access文件和Excel文件的方法詳解
相關(guān)文章
C# WinForm自動(dòng)更新程序之文件上傳操作詳解
這篇文章主要為大家詳細(xì)介紹了C# WinForm自動(dòng)更新程序中文件上傳操作,文中的示例代碼講解詳細(xì),具有一定的借鑒價(jià)值,感興趣的小伙伴可以了解一下2022-10-10
C#根據(jù)IP地址查詢所屬地區(qū)實(shí)例詳解
這篇文章主要介紹了C#根據(jù)IP地址查詢所屬地區(qū)實(shí)例詳解,調(diào)用的接口是免費(fèi)的接口,有需要的同學(xué)可以研究下2021-03-03
C#實(shí)現(xiàn)通過模板自動(dòng)創(chuàng)建Word文檔的方法
這篇文章主要介紹了C#實(shí)現(xiàn)通過模板自動(dòng)創(chuàng)建Word文檔的方法,詳細(xì)講述了C#生成Word文檔的實(shí)現(xiàn)方法,是非常實(shí)用的技巧,需要的朋友可以參考下2014-09-09
C#實(shí)現(xiàn)windows form倒計(jì)時(shí)的方法
這篇文章主要介紹了C#實(shí)現(xiàn)windows form倒計(jì)時(shí)的方法,涉及C#桌面程序設(shè)計(jì)中時(shí)間操作的技巧,非常具有實(shí)用價(jià)值,需要的朋友可以參考下2015-04-04
如何在C#項(xiàng)目中鏈接一個(gè)文件夾下的所有文件詳解
很多時(shí)候我們需要獲取一個(gè)結(jié)構(gòu)未知的文件夾下所有的文件或是指定類型的所有文件,下面這篇文章主要給大家介紹了關(guān)于如何在C#項(xiàng)目中鏈接一個(gè)文件夾下的所有文件,需要的朋友可以參考下2023-02-02

